When you think of working for the RSPCA you probably think of our frontline staff; inspectors, animal welfare officers, veterinary nurses, veterinary surgeons, grooms, wildlife assistants and animal care assistants. But if they're all the people you imagine working for us then think again!

 

As well as our officers, vets, vet nurses and grooms we have jobs for scientists, journalists, administrators, fundraisers, campaigners, IT specialists and more.


We have people working in jobs you may not have even considered and they all have one goal in mind – to improve animal welfare.
